Mower Mayhem II

Dana Boyles released her adult daughter’s 4-1/2 foot python, Delilah, from their Athens, Ohio, residence, she admits, after her daughter stopped feeding it. Boyles allegedly told a sheriff’s deputy that she intended to run it over with a lawn mower, but the snake escaped. Hocking Woods Nature Center director Dave Sagan located and captured Delilah. While some residents expressed concern about a snake on the loose, Sagan said it was too small to be a danger. Delilah is being held at the Nature Center until local authorities decide what to do with it. Meanwhile, Athens County Sheriff Pat Kelly announced that snake hunters spotted some marijuana plants inside a trailer at the park, leading to a search of the premises. That turned up other drugs and paraphernalia — and a 5-year-old child in the house. The case has been referred to Children’s Services. “The evidence will be sent to the lab for testing,” Kelly said.
